Marie F. Perkins
Marie F. Perkins, 77, of Hillsboro, died Wednesday, May 23, 2012 at Heartland of Hillsboro.
She was born in Buena Vista, Ohio on April 11, 1935, the daughter of the late Raymond C. and Elsie A. (Greene) Monteith.
Marie retired after 35 years of employment, during which she worked 19 years at Great Scot in Hillsboro and at Huhtamaki in New Vienna. Marie was most at home in her kitchen canning vegetables, working in the garden or serving her family, friends and neighbors blackberry cobbler and homemade rolls. Those who knew her know the world will be just a little bit dimmer without her in it.
On Oct. 8, 1955, she was united in marriage to Elzie Perkins, who survives.
